This paper reviews recent developments in integrated fluidic mesosystems, based on low-temperature co-fired ceramic (LTCC) technology, in this laboratory and elsewhere. LTCC is shown to be an advantageous technique for integrated fluidic systems, due to its simplicity, low cost and ease of integration with other technologies and components (silicon, polymer, circuit boards. Prior to the mid 1980s, the dominance of through-hole packaging of integrated circuits (ICs) provided easy access to nearly every pin of every chip on a printed circuit board. Providing accessibility and controllability for board testing was simply a matter of probing the board.
